Pugliese - Failure to Launch51 viewsThis was a dough that just died on the proving rack. All looked good until I put it to rise for baking, and then... Nothing much happened. It baked up gooey and very sticky-gooey in the center. Most of the evidence points to over-fermentation during bulk rise. Threw out the entire batch.
